大数据项目实战第3章 数据采集 -教学设计.doc
《大数据项目实战第3章 数据采集 -教学设计.doc》由会员分享,可在线阅读,更多相关《大数据项目实战第3章 数据采集 -教学设计.doc(5页珍藏版)》请在汇文网上搜索。
1、黑马程序员大数据项目实战教学设计课程名称: 大数据项目实战 授课年级: 20xx年级 授课学期: 20xx学年第一学期 教师姓名: 某某老师 2019年9月1日课题名称第3章 数据采集计划学时7课时内容分析数据是开展本书项目重要的基础,有了这些数据才能明确我们的分析内容。本章将实现网络数据采集程序。教学目标及基本要求1、 了解HTTP协议2、 了解爬虫的基本原理3、 掌握HDFS API的基本使用4、 熟悉HttpClient爬虫的使用方法教学重点1、 通过HttpClient编写网络爬虫程序2、 HDFS API的应用3、 HTTP请求过程教学难点1、 HttpClient编写网络爬虫程序教
2、学方式教师课堂教学要以讲演法讲授为主,并结合多媒体进行教学教学过程第一课时(数据源分类、HTTP请求过程、认识HttpClient)一、网络数据采集1. 网络数据采集知识概要在编写数据采集程序前,对网络数据采集所涉及的知识点做简单介绍,奠定网络数据采集的基础知识。本节课将针对这些知识点进行讲解。2. 明确学习目标(1)了解采集数据源的分类(2)了解HTTP请求过程(3)了解HttpClient网络框架二、进行重点知识讲解 1采集数据源的分类 教师可以参考课件对三大类数据源:系统日志采集、网络数据采集和数据库采集进行简要讲解,并介绍本项目使用的数据源。 2HTTP请求过程 教师可以参考课件以讲演
3、法的方式讲解,在浏览器中输入URL链接打开网页,通过浏览器提供的开发者工具对HTTP请求过程、HTTP请求以及HTTP响应进行详细讲解,并对相应请求中包含的参数及内容进行介绍,使学生在后续编写爬虫程序使用这些参数时有一定来了解。 3HttpClient网络框架教师可以参考课件讲解HttpClient发送请求到接收响应的过程,为后续以HttpClient为基础编写的爬虫程序奠定基础。三、归纳总结,随堂练习,布置作业 1对课堂上讲解的知识点进行总结。2让学生自己动手通过浏览器动手操作,以此来巩固本节的学习内容。第二课时(分析网页数据结构、数据采集环境准备)一、回顾上一节内容,讲解通过HTTP请求获
- 1.请仔细阅读文档,确保文档完整性,对于不预览、不比对内容而直接下载带来的问题本站不予受理。
- 2.下载的文档,不会出现我们的网址水印。
- 3、该文档所得收入(下载+内容+预览)归上传者、原创作者;如果您是本文档原作者,请点此认领!既往收益都归您。
下载文档到电脑,查找使用更方便
10 积分
下载 | 加入VIP,下载共享资源 |
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 大数据项目实战第3章 数据采集 -教学设计 数据 项目 实战 采集 教学 设计